Diaphragm's Manual Therapy in Patients With Chronic Neck Pain

About

The aim of this study is to evaluate the effect of diaphragm's manual therapy in addition to cervical spine manual therapy in terms of pain, cervical spine range of motion, trigger points pain pressure threshold, disability and quality of life in patient with chronic aspecific neck pain.

Enrollment

40 patients

Sex

All

Ages

18 to 65 years old

Volunteers

No Healthy Volunteers

Inclusion criteria

  • Neck pain since at least 3 months
  • Age > 18 years and < 65 years
  • Male or Female

Exclusion criteria

  • Pregnancy
  • Contraindications for manual therapy or inability to complete the treatment
  • Patients who received a physiotherapy or osteopathic treatment during the last 3 months
  • Medical diagnosis of rheumatologic disease
  • Medical diagnosis of respiratory disease (COPD, asthma)
  • Spine surgery
  • Medical diagnosis of past or present cancer
  • Thoracic or abdominal surgery in the last 3 years
  • Whiplash injuries
  • Previous cervical fracture
  • Cervical anatomical changes
  • Thrombotic events
  • Body temperature greater than 37 degrees in the previous 48 hours
  • Obesity (BMI greater than 30)

Trial design

Primary purpose

Treatment

Allocation

Randomized

Interventional model

Parallel Assignment

Masking

Double Blind

40 participants in 2 patient groups

Real Treatment Group
Experimental group
Description:
Patients included in this group will receive 3 multifaced physiotherapy/osteopathic treatments + experimental manoeuvres, 1 treatment/week. Each session will last about 30 minutes.
Treatment:
Behavioral: Real Treatment Group
Sham Treatment Group
Sham Comparator group
Description:
Patients included in this group will receive 3 multifaced physiotherapy/osteopathic treatments + sham manoeuvres, 1 treatment/week. Each session will last about 30 minutes.
Treatment:
Behavioral: Sham Treatment Group
